Nunez Community College (NCC), officially Elaine P. Nunez Community College, is a public community college in Chalmette, Louisiana, serving St. Bernard and Plaquemines parishes. It offers academic, technical, and workforce development programs.

Core associate degree and technical certificate programs blending general education with occupational training.
Short-term workforce training including Wind Program with GWO-certified modules and heavy equipment certifications.
Pathways for adult learners including high school equivalency preparation.
Dual-credit opportunities for area high school students.
